Abstract
A method and a device for a distributed duration for traffic lights. The method includes: calculating an effective delay time and an effective driving time of floating cars passing through a given intersection based on statistical data; then according to the driving loci of the floating cars, sorting the floating cars passing through the given intersection based on the statistical data into three classes: turning left, turning right and through traffic; and finally, calculating the distributed duration for the traffic lights according to the effective delay time and the effective driving time of the floating cars passing through the given intersection based on the statistical data. The present invention relates to the field of intelligent transport systems, and achieves the calculation of a distributed duration for traffic lights while reducing the hardware cost.
